자바스크립트 Local Storage를 이용한 웹 사이트 업데이트 알림

웹 사이트의 콘텐츠를 업데이트하는 것은 사용자들이 항상 최신 정보를 얻을 수 있도록 하는 중요한 요소입니다. 자바스크립트 Local Storage를 사용하면 사용자에게 업데이트 된 내용을 알리는 데 도움을 줄 수 있습니다. 이 글에서는 자바스크립트 Local Storage를 사용하여 웹 사이트 업데이트 알림 기능을 구현하는 방법을 알아보겠습니다.

Local Storage란?

Local Storage는 웹 브라우저에 데이터를 저장할 수 있는 기능입니다. 이 데이터는 웹 사이트를 방문할 때마다 유지되며, 페이지를 닫거나 다시 방문해도 유지됩니다. 이를 이용하여 웹 사이트 업데이트 알림을 구현할 수 있습니다.

업데이트 알림 기능 구현 방법

  1. 새로운 콘텐츠를 업데이트할 때마다, Local Storage에 업데이트된 내용의 버전 번호를 저장합니다. (#LocalStorage #업데이트알림) ```javascript // 업데이트된 콘텐츠 버전 번호 const updatedVersion = 2;

// Local Storage에 버전 번호 저장 localStorage.setItem(‘version’, updatedVersion);


2. 페이지를 로드할 때마다, Local Storage에서 저장된 버전 번호와 현재 콘텐츠 버전 번호를 비교합니다.
```javascript
// 현재 콘텐츠 버전 번호
const currentVersion = 2;

// Local Storage에서 저장된 버전 번호 가져오기
const savedVersion = localStorage.getItem('version');

// 버전 번호 비교
if (savedVersion && currentVersion > savedVersion) {
  // 업데이트 알림을 보여줍니다.
  alert('새로운 콘텐츠가 업데이트되었습니다!');
}
  1. 업데이트 알림이 필요한 경우, 사용자에게 알림을 표시합니다.

위의 코드는 간단한 예시로서, 웹 사이트의 업데이트 내용과 알림 디자인 등을 추가로 개발해야합니다. 또한, 콘텐츠 버전 번호는 페이지 로드 시 서버에서도 가져와야하며, 실제로 업데이트가 있을 때만 Local Storage에 버전 번호를 업데이트해야합니다.

웹 사이트의 콘텐츠를 업데이트하고 사용자에게 알리는 것은 사용자 경험을 향상시키는데 도움이 됩니다. 자바스크립트 Local Storage를 사용하여 업데이트 알림 기능을 구현하면 사용자가 항상 최신 정보를 얻을 수 있도록 할 수 있습니다.

#LocalStorage #업데이트알림